Turning this Wagon Train Around: General Convention 78
History tells us that as the Mormon settlers were making Salt Lake City their home, Brigham Young insisted that the streets be wide enough for a wagon team to turn around “without resorting to profanity.” How appropriate that the Episcopal Church is having our 78th General Convention in this fair city.
